Keyless Entry System
Smart keys are included on most lamborghini key programming models. They are able to unlock and lock the doors as well as start the car and disarm the immobilizer without the requirement for the traditional metal key. Smart keys function by using an electronic transponder located at the key's end. It communicates with car's computer via a coded signal when the key is within five feet.
The keys contain the controller chip, which generates a 40-bit code each time the key's transmitter button is pressed. The code is sent to the receiver. This code prevents the receiver and transmitter from detecting signals from each other so that the key can only be used on one specific lamborghini sian key at a given time.
To duplicate a key that is digital, you will need a special digital coding device that must be purchased from a licensed lamborghini keys dealer or locksmith. This is a costly equipment and is the primary reason why re-creating an electronic key is more expensive than cutting a conventional metal bladed car key.
Key Fob
The key fob is fitted with a small transmitter that communicates using Radio Frequency Identification technology (RFID). It transmits a coded message to an RFID chip inside the vehicle. The RFID chip then transmits the information back to the key fob. When the key fob is activated the car is able to detect the information transmitted by the chip and act accordingly.
The fob might also have buttons that activate other functions, such as locking and unlocking doors, activating the power sunroof and folding the power side mirrors. It also can start the car and flash a red light to inform you that it's done so.
Fobs are easy to replace, and you can pick up the new one at an auto dealer or from a retailer that sells them. You can also refer to the owner's manual, which contains instructions for replacing the battery yourself. In the majority of instances, this is an easy task that takes just a few minutes.

Remote Keyless System Receiver module
The receiver is an radio frequency (RF) unit that houses the programming logic for the RKE system. It is located under the lower instrument panel of the passenger near the glove box opening. The RF receiver is radio transmitter operating at 315 MHz, reads and decodes data from the RKE keyfob. The data stream is usually between 64 and 128 bits and consists of an intro, command code and rolling codes. The RF signal employs amplitude-shift keying to decrease battery consumption and increase transmission range.
